Delbarton, WV Heat Pump Repair Pros

Duct Repair in Delbarton, WV
Fix leaky or crushed ducts in Delbarton, WV.


Best Duct Repair in Delbarton, WV
Restore performance with expert duct repair in Delbarton, WV. Call (833) 7791706 now.